Some important facts about Leipzig University’s Sanskrit program include: |
|
1. The Department of Indology and Tamil Studies at Leipzig University was established in 1854, making it one of the oldest such departments in Europe. |
|
2. The university offers a wide range of courses in Sanskrit language, literature, philosophy, and culture, allowing students to gain a comprehensive understanding of the ancient language and its significance in Indian history and culture. |
|
3. The department is known for its strong emphasis on research and scholarship in the field of Sanskrit studies, with faculty members actively engaged in publishing their work and participating in international conferences and symposia. |
|
4. Leipzig University has a well-stocked library with a collection of rare Sanskrit manuscripts and texts, providing students with valuable resources for their studies. |
|
5. The university also offers opportunities for students to participate in exchange programs with universities in India, allowing them to immerse themselves in the language and culture firsthand. |
|
Overall, Leipzig University’s Sanskrit program is highly regarded for its academic excellence and commitment to furthering the understanding of this ancient language.
